On a related note, I keep hearing that the Big 12 doesn't want to add teams at least partially because they think a Big 12 championship game hurts their chances in the BCS. I disagree. I think SEC teams have the big advantage because they don't have to play all the other SEC teams every year, like the Big 12 does. Sure, the SEC has a championship game, but the winner of that game still didn't have to play all the difficult teams in the SEC.
Tell me how Georgia is ranked #5? They've played two teams currently in the top 25 - winning one and losing one. What a brutal SEC schedule! Even if they lose in the championship game, they still only end up with 2 loses and will have only played three good teams. Big 12 teams will have played at least 4-5 teams currently in the top 25. How does that benefit the Big 12? I think this is a big part of the reason there are six SEC teams in the top 10 (BCS) and only two Big 12 teams in the top 12. The Big 12 teams all have to play each other (and beat each other).
What do you guys think? Does this make any sense? I think the Big 12 would have a better chance at BCS bowl games if they had two divisions and a conference title game. This would actually make their schedules easier.
